Prithvi Shaw – One of the players missing in the Indian batting line-up was the young sensation, Prithvi Shaw. The 18-year-old batsman has shown his prowess in first-class cricket. Hence, Rahul Dravid asked him to play Ranji Trophy to raise his bar. Mumbai’s gain was India U19’s loss, and as a result, India U-19s suffered the second biggest upset in the history of junior cricket.

Shaw has four centuries to his name in six first-class games and has a real chance of playing for the Indian team. Though he will play U19 World Cup, as Dravid has said, no one can stop his selection in India team if he comes up with few good knocks in ongoing Ranji season.
